The Race
Simple…
Runners race against horses!
- Runners capped at 200.
- Horses (with riders) capped at 60.
40k Human vs Horse race
Humans start off 15 minutes early. Then horses start. Run the same route.
Final race time is the time between the start and finish for each species.
So if a human finishes first, they have to wait 15 minutes to know if they have actually won!
There is a vet check at the halfway point. The vet check time is included in the race time. The fitter the horse, the quicker the vet check!
There is another vet check after the finish. Horses must pass this vet check or be disqualified.
25k Human and Horse Fun Run
Humans start off 15 minutes early. Then horses start. Run the same route.
There is a vet check after the finish. Horses must pass this vet check or be disqualified.
